Steel-reinforced concrete is used ubiquitously as a building
material due to its unique combination of the high compressive
strength of concrete and the high tensile strength of steel.
Therefore, reinforced concrete is an ideal composite material that
is used for a wide range of applications in structural engineering
such as buildings, bridges, tunnels, harbor quays, foundations,
tanks and pipes. To ensure durability of these structures, however,
measures must be taken to prevent, diagnose and, if necessary,
repair damage to the material especially due to corrosion of the
steel reinforcement.
The book examines the different aspects of corrosion of steel in
concrete, starting from basic and essential mechanisms of the
phenomenon,
moving up to practical consequences for designers, contractors and
owners both for new and existing reinforced and prestressed
concrete
structures. It covers general aspects of corrosion and protection
of reinforcement, forms of attack in the presence of carbonation
and chlorides,
problems of hydrogen embrittlement as well as techniques of
diagnosis, monitoring and repair. This second edition updates the
contents with
recent findings on the different topics considered and
bibliographic references, with particular attention to recent
European standards. This
book is a self-contained treatment for civil and construction
engineers, material scientists, advanced students and architects
concerned with the design and maintenance of reinforced concrete
structures. Readers will benefit from the knowledge, tools, and
methods needed to understand corrosion in reinforced concrete and
how to prevent it or keep it within acceptable limits.
